N₂ or O₂ assist gas for precision cutting. O₂ enables exothermic reaction for faster carbon steel cutting. N₂ produces bright, dross-free stainless edges — no secondary finishing needed.
High-pressure N₂ (10–20 bar) blows molten material away, producing bright, oxide-free edges on stainless steel. No secondary deburring or grinding required.
O₂ assist gas adds exothermic energy, enabling 20–40% faster cutting speeds on carbon steel up to 25mm. Higher throughput per machine hour.
On-site generation eliminates cylinder rental, delivery surcharges, and changeover downtime. Continuous 24/7 gas supply for production lines.
Single on-site system can supply both N₂ and O₂. Switch between gases instantly for different materials and thicknesses.

| Parameter | Value |
|---|---|
| Gas Pressure | 10–20 bar |
| Flow Rate | 20–100 Nm³/h per machine |
| N₂ Purity | 99.5% (cutting grade) |
| O₂ Purity | 93%+ (VPSA) |
| Material Thickness | Up to 25mm (carbon steel) |
| Payback | 8–12 months |
